How to Open a Presentation: 7 Presentation Opening Techniques That Command the Room

The way you open a presentation decides how your audience responds from the very beginning. Strong presentation opening techniques help capture attention, create engagement and set the tone for the rest of your presentation. 

1. Lead with a Storytelling Opening for Presentations

Perhaps the most broadly applicable strategy for presenting concepts is to begin with an effective story. It is easier to process story-based information than abstract information. When you begin your speech with a concrete scenario, such as a client problem, a market development, or a major point in your business, you create an emotional connection with the audience, pushing them to listen.

Keep it short and simple, only two or three sentences, and express the scenario and issue in one breath. storytelling opening for presentations may be quite effective, especially when doing a sales presentation or a transformation presentation, when you need an emotional connection to get your point across.

2. Use a Problem Statement Opener to Create Immediate Urgency

Decision-makers respond to issues more quickly than on solutions. A strong problem statement opener you may transform your presentation from an activity that your audience must suffer to an issue that they must address.

The essential trick here is to be specific. The more ambiguous the situation is expressed, the less focused your listeners’ attention will be. Everyone will immediately pay attention to your presentation once you define their specific business difficulty or the exact amount of money and time it costs them. Instead of being just another presenter passing out information, you become an authority in their sector, ready to assist.

This method works especially well for boardroom presentations, strategic sessions, and large sales pitches. Begin with the problem, make it tangible, personal, and relevant, and watch as your audience works for you.

3. How to Start a Pitch Deck with a Bold, Specific Statistic

Numbers are typically more attention-grabbing than words. A simple but well-chosen statistic in your introduction can have the entire room thinking differently before it fully develops your actual introductory sentence.

The number must be justified in your proposal. Generic numbers on your market size are ineffective. What works is something unexpected, shocking, or related to an impact that people experience on a personal level. 4. Ask a Question Your Audience Cannot Immediately Answer

Statements and questions have various effects on the mind. By asking an initial question that does not have an obvious quick response, you create an engagement loop: a mental engagement that maintains attention even when the issue remains unanswered.

Your audience may not provide an answer to the query. Rather, it is most successful when stated rhetorically at the beginning of your presentation and answered in less than two minutes. The moment between questions and answers is when your audience is most engaged.

This may be one of the most effective techniques to engage your audience at the start of your presentation. Unfortunately, this is one of the most underappreciated methods utilised by executive speakers today. Senior executives typically respond positively to queries about their market environments, organisations, and competitive positioning.

6. Open with a Contrarian Statement That Challenges the Conventional Wisdom

Nothing is more startling than a remark that contradicts the entire belief system of an audience composed of experienced business executives. The idea here is to upset your listeners’ mental patterns. 

Everyone has preexisting assumptions about the industry, company, or market you’re discussing. All it takes is the first sentence that confidently breaks this pattern, promising some evidence along the way to generate a level of engagement that cannot be achieved any other way.

This type of opening requires both intellectual conviction and facts that may be presented promptly. It is best suited for keynote speeches at conventions where the audience is well-informed and easily bored; presentations to investors where the goal is to stand out from the crowd; and strategic brainstorming sessions where the organisation’s thinking needs to be changed.

7. Begin with Silence and Deliberate Presence

This is the presentation strategy that most presenters never use, but it has the most influence on the audiences that matter.

Wait three to five seconds before speaking. Make eye contact with confidence and assurance. Embrace the power of silence. Most presenters find it difficult to remain silent during their presentation. They feel uneasy as presenters. When you take the time to pause in a calm manner before speaking, your audience will see and hear something completely different. During those few seconds of silence, you position yourself as someone who has complete control of the situation.

Use this tactic with any of the other methods discussed above to increase emphasis. By pausing before speaking, you are preparing your audience for whatever message you choose to offer. If your message arrives after a moment of stillness, it will have 10 times the impact. This presentation method works best in high-pressure scenarios, such as boardroom meetings and C-level discussions.

Choosing the Right Opening Style for Your Audience

However, not all the approaches for starting your presentation may be appropriate in every situation. What actually counts is the type of audience you’re addressing, your aim, and the type of link you’re attempting to establish. While a statement intended to take the opposing stance might generate enthusiasm from an entire conference hall, the same method can sound arrogant in a private boardroom situation. 

Similarly, while an introductory narrative is ideal for a client presentation, it will fall flat in a more formal investor question-and-answer session. It all boils down to choosing the best method for your target audience.
